Code:Dim strStars As String
Dim intSize As Integer
Dim strResponse As String
Dim intMax As Integer
' Keep producing patterns until the user enters zero
Do Until strResponse = "0"
' imitialize stars
strStars = "*"
' Get the maximum size from the user. Use 10 as the suggested value.
strResponse = InputBox("How big do you want the longest row to be? " _
& "(1 to 100 or 0 to quit)", "Stars!", 10)
Select Case True
Case Len(strResponse) = 0
' The user pressed "Cancel"
MsgBox "Please enter a number between 0 and 100"
Case strResponse = "0"
MsgBox "Bye"
Exit Do
Case Val(strResponse) > 0 And Val(strResponse) < 101
' Convert the response to a number
intMax = Val(strResponse)
If MsgBox("Do you want the rows to start small and get bigger?", _
vbQuestion + vbYesNo, "Which direction?") = vbYes Then
' Bigger is easy
For intSize = 1 To intMax
strStars = strStars & "*"
Debug.Print strStars
Next
Else
' Smaller is only a little harder. First create a string
' that contains the maximum number od stars
For intSize = 1 To intMax
strStars = strStars & "*"
Next
' Then shorten and print it until it's a single star
For intSize = intMax To 1 Step -1
Debug.Print Left$(strStars, intSize)
Next
End If
Case Else
MsgBox "Invalid response, please try again."
End Select
Loop
End
I finally found my star drawing sub. Currently, it just draws a simplistic star of a given number of points. I'm trying to make it do triangular points instead of just lines, but that's a little harder.
You can do whatever you wish with this. Anyone that's had trig can do it. :)Code:Public Sub DrawStar(objTarget As Object, sngX As Single, sngY As Single, sngRadius As Single, Optional intPoints As Integer = 5, Optional intMode As Integer = vbCopyPen, Optional intStyle As Integer = vbSolid, Optional intWidth As Integer = 1, Optional lngColor As OLE_COLOR = vbBlack)
Dim i As Integer
Dim intOldDrawMode As Integer
Dim intOldDrawStyle As Integer
Dim intOldDrawWidth As Integer
Dim sngPi As Single
If (TypeOf objTarget Is PictureBox) Or (TypeOf objTarget Is Form) Then
sngPi = 4 * Atn(1)
If intWidth <= 0 Then intWidth = 1
If intPoints <= 0 Then intPoints = 1
intOldDrawMode = objTarget.DrawMode
intOldDrawStyle = objTarget.DrawStyle
intOldDrawWidth = objTarget.DrawWidth
objTarget.DrawMode = intMode
objTarget.DrawStyle = intStyle
objTarget.DrawWidth = intWidth
For i = 0 To (intPoints - 1)
objTarget.Line (sngX, sngY)-(sngX + (sngRadius * Sin(((2 * sngPi) / intPoints) * i)), sngY + (-sngRadius * Cos(((2 * sngPi) / intPoints) * i))), lngColor
Next i
objTarget.DrawMode = intOldDrawMode
objTarget.DrawStyle = intOldDrawStyle
objTarget.DrawWidth = intOldDrawWidth
End If
End Sub
